An In-Depth Look at the Rainforest Trail Ride

What’s Included and What to Expect
This tour offers a guided trail ride lasting about 60 minutes, making it a perfect afternoon activity that won’t consume your entire day. The ride takes you into the Wao Kele o Puna Forest Reserve, which means you’ll experience Hawaii’s native rainforest at its most lush and vibrant. The trail is quiet and less traveled, providing a peaceful setting far from the crowds.
You’ll be riding gentle horses, chosen for their calm nature, making it suitable for riders who already have intermediate or advanced riding skills. Helmets are provided free of charge, emphasizing safety, and the guides will be there to help you navigate the terrain and ensure your comfort.

FAQ

Is this tour suitable for beginners?
This ride is designed for intermediate and advanced riders. If you’re comfortable walking, trotting, and cantering, you’ll enjoy it. Beginners might find it too challenging, especially on uneven terrain.
How long does the ride last?
The guided trail ride lasts approximately one hour. It’s a manageable duration that leaves plenty of time in your day for other activities.
What is included in the price?
Your fee covers the guided trail ride, all necessary equipment including helmets, photos of the ride, and cold beverages like soda and water after the ride.
Are helmets provided?
Yes, helmets are provided free of charge for all participants, underscoring the tour’s focus on safety.
What should I wear?
Dress comfortably for riding; closed-toe shoes are required (no open-toed shoes). Long pants are recommended to protect your legs from brush.
Can I cancel the tour if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. You can also reserve now and pay later to keep your plans flexible.
Is this experience appropriate for children?
No, it’s not suitable for children under 13 and is geared toward those with riding experience.
What happens after the ride?
You can relax at the ranch, enjoy your photos, and shop for locally made products. The covered picnic area is perfect for unwinding with a cold drink.
Where do I meet for the tour?
Look for the large teak gate entrance at Ola Nani Ranch. The guides will be ready to greet you there.
